Pan Am Games a Park family affair, 3 Winnipeg siblings coached by father in taekwondo - Winnipeg

Jae Park has a family-sized job ahead of him at the Pan American Games. He'll coach his three children Skylar, Tae-Ku and Braven in taekwondo on opening weekend in Santiago, Chile.
